Solution for (2x+2)=(x+56) equation:


Simplifying
(2x + 2) = (x + 56)

Reorder the terms:
(2 + 2x) = (x + 56)

Remove parenthesis around (2 + 2x)
2 + 2x = (x + 56)

Reorder the terms:
2 + 2x = (56 + x)

Remove parenthesis around (56 + x)
2 + 2x = 56 + x

Solving
2 + 2x = 56 + x

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-1x' to each side of the equation.
2 + 2x + -1x = 56 + x + -1x

Combine like terms: 2x + -1x = 1x
2 + 1x = 56 + x + -1x

Combine like terms: x + -1x = 0
2 + 1x = 56 + 0
2 + 1x = 56

Add '-2' to each side of the equation.
2 + -2 + 1x = 56 + -2

Combine like terms: 2 + -2 = 0
0 + 1x = 56 + -2
1x = 56 + -2

Combine like terms: 56 + -2 = 54
1x = 54

Divide each side by '1'.
x = 54

Simplifying
x = 54
